New Church Procedures Regarding Use of The Fellowship Hall and Family Life Center
God has blessed us with both a Fellowship Hall and a Family Life Center and we want everyone to be able to enjoy it. We also want to ensure that it is used in a way that will not bring dishonor to God or to the church. To make sure that everyone understands what is expected of them if they use these facilities, we have adopted some new procedures. Please note that these apply both to individuals requesting use of the facilities for personal use (baby showers, weddings, birthday parties, etc.) and also to groups within Batley who wish to use the facility (Sunday School parties, Senior functions, etc.) These rules apply to the Fellowship Hall, the Family Life Center and any other church buildings. Requests must be completed two weeks in advance. You may pick up a request form from the church office or from the Fellowship Committee (Carol Woodard is head of this committee). Once the form is completed and returned, it will be brought before the Fellowship Committee for approval and you will be notified of the results. Also, church functions will always have priority over individual use. The church reserves the right to cancel an individual’s permission to use the facilities if it is discovered that the requested time conflicts with a church function.
